Dodd Calls for a "Complete Repeal" of "Don't Ask, Don't Tell"

By The Hill - 03/20/07 05:39 AM ET
In this recent campaign video, Sen. Chris Dodd (D-Conn.) reacts to Chairman of the Joint Chiefs of Staff Peter Pace's remarks last week that homosexuality is immoral and his opposition to the "Don't Ask, Don't Tell" policy.

"At a time when we need to be recruiting some good, talented people," Dodd said, "At a time of war...the idea that we'd exclude a whole bunch of people that may otherwise qualify based on sexual orientation I think is wrong."
